Internal problems like ruptured pipes and overflows can result in emergency flooding. Maintain on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.
1. Shut Off Main Water Shutoff
Pipelines can break as a result of freezing temps, high pressure, blockage, water heater issues, and other elements. Regardless of the cause, you have to act rapidly to guarantee porous home materials, home appliances, and home furnishings do not soak up the water, resulting in damage. Shut down the main shutoff before you do any type of cleaning to guarantee water quits gathering. Killing the water source is simple, and it is something you can do yourself. As for the ruptured pipe, call for emergency situation plumbing solutions to fix it as soon as possible.
2. Turn off the Breaker
With a large flooding, you require to make sure the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or deaths. Shut off the circuit bre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can not do it, make a quick call to the power company to close the key line. Keep the power off until excess water is gone.
3. Move Vital Wet Times
When it involves conserving your furnishings and also home appliances, time is of the essence. You should relocate whatever whet personal belongings you can from the affected area to a completely dry area. This discourages additional damages because the longer they soak in water, the a lot more considerable the problem.
4. Document the Degree of Damages
Bear in mind of all the damages brought upon by the ruptured pipe. You can jot down notes, take images, and also accumulate videos. This is a terrific means to supply proof to collect cases on your house insurance coverage. With paperwork, you can also obtain a clear photo of the level of the damage.
5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P
You should get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Must there be a huge quantity of standing water, you might require a water pump for extraction.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the remainder with old t-sh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Area
You can likewise establish up electrical followers as well as placed them in the best setting. A dehumidifier likewise works in taking out moisture to avoid mildew and molds.
7. Work with Professionals
When you endure substantial water damages as a result of em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can work with a remediation expert to reconstruct and remodel your residence. Most of all, don't fail to remember to call a respectable plumber to repair the ruptured pipe and also examine the remainder of your piping system.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one location, you need to be made use of now on what to do, where to go and also what to need to be planned for poor weather condition. If you're not utilized to getting mauled by high winds and tough rain, you probably do not have an idea exactly how best to deal with a tornado circumstance.
For starters, storms do not just come without a caution. Weather stations keep track of the ambience all the time. If a tornado is possible, they will release two sorts of warnings:
Storm watch-- is provided when there is a feasible storm in your location.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, over cast sky, an uncommonly gusty day and some rain. The storm might or might not come, yet this is the time to keep tuned to your local radio for information and also updates.
Storm warning-- is released when a tornado is headed towards your area. Try to remain indoors as long as feasible. Or if locals are suggested to evacuate to a much safer location, go as early as you can. Do not wait till the eleventh hour to leave your house. By that time, the streets could be swamped as well as website traffic misbehaves. You don't want to be caught in your cars and truck in bad weather.
Blizzard-- usually takes place in winter and also suggests heavy snow, strong winds and also wind chill. When a caution is issued, stay clear of taking a trip as long as possible and also remain indoors. There is no use revealing on your own outdoors where you could get entraped in website traffic or in areas where you will be difficult to reach or worse, locate.
Things do not constantly go bad throughout tornados, yet climate is uncertain and also anything can happen. To assist you prepare for a storm emergency situation, right here are a few pointers:
Dress up.
Use sufficient clothes to maintain on your own cozy. Warm might not be available in your home so get additional layers and coverings to preserve your body temperature sufficiently.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ots all set.
Have food prepared.
Emergency situation stipulations are a must throughout storm emergencies. If the tornado gets too negative as well as the streets are swamped,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ery stores.
Keep containers of water helpful. Clean water might be hard ahead by during actually negative conditions and the most awful point you can do is experience dehydration because you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at the very least one gallon for each individual da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the bathtub.
You'll require more water for washing and also fl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your tub, water containers as well as pails with water. If you have little kids in your home, take safety measures by covering deep containers and maintaining children far from the shower room unless required.
Emergency situation kit
Have a medical or very first package ready and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It must consist of an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also necessary medications. It's likewise a great concept to have an additional kit in your cars and truck.
If any individual in your family is under special drug, ensure you have adequate supplies to last up until after the tornado is over and medicine shops are open.
Lights off
Expect power blackouts during tornado emergency situations. You won't have any kind of power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and also em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ries as well as suits in case you go out.
If you can not activate the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a terminal that covers your area. Media will keep track of the storm and will maintain you upgraded.
You may require hot water during the duration when power is not yet offered, so keep a little container of gas around simply in case. Your outdoor barbecue grill will certainly do nicely.
Get an alternative sanctuary.
If you assume your home will suffer significantly, it's a good concept to consider an alternating shelter. It could be an evacuation facility or one more house or structure that is more secure. Make certain you have adequate gas in your container in case you need to leave your home as well as move some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have far better chances of being risk-free as well as completely dry.
